Delhi
Prince Singh 4 years ago
Follow
Type your answer here
8 Answers
Tnvi chopra
Follow
4 years ago
Top Answer
Momo queen, momo factory
richa gupta
Follow
4 years ago
Momo factory is the best place to eat momos. You'll find a variety of momos there which all taste really well
Harminder Kaur
Follow
4 years ago
Brown sugar
Devansh Gupta
Follow
4 years ago
Momo factory
Sameer Shareef
Follow
4 years ago
Wow momo
Manav Bal
Follow
4 years ago
Hunger strike amar colony
Ashita Dubey
Follow
4 years ago
Wow momos
Pallavi Kandhari
Follow
4 years ago
Brown Sugar
Answer
Bookmark